For me, firefox does appear to work, as you mentioned.  Nautilus does
not work, however (I didn't think nautilus was QT, so it might be a
wider issue than you've seen).   Pressing my alt key does activate the
menus (I see all the menus, with the key letter underlined in each), but
pressing a letter does not activate that particular menu.  If I click on
a menu with the mouse, pressing the letter for a sub item of that menu
does activate that item.
